Mastering Fluid Typography and Responsive Design Metrics
Building responsive user interfaces demands a deep understanding of relative and absolute layout units. While traditional software engineering relied on fixed pixel spaces, modern multi-screen ecosystems require flexible properties like REM and percentage ratios to preserve layout proportions. The mathematical tools embedded here facilitate these conversions instantly, helping front-end developers achieve pixel-perfect accuracy without manual compounding errors.
